Would a sitewide link to a 1mb exe download harm rankings?
-
We're in a games market and we have a link on every page to our download. The link is an aspx but there is no downloadpage as such - clicking on the link triggers an executable download that is just less than one meg.
We've been looking at the top results in our very competitive market and the top 8 don't seem to have a download.
Coincidence or a real factor?

Also the fact the url of the exe is an .aspx page could be seen as deceitful. I wouldn't do it like that. Since you use dot.net, use a httphandler and match url with file extension. And I would not serve an .exe, zip it and serve a .zip file.
And I strongly support donford advice about a download page for all the good reasons he is referring to.

Interesting question, I have never heard downloads having a negative impact on SERP's but I can clearly see why they "could".
I don't know if this is a factor or not, this may be tough to answer accurately. I do not see "downloadable .exe files" on any tried and true ranking factors list (like searchmetrics.com) but that really could only mean somebody hasn't done a comprehensive A & B test.
With your concern about it "possibly" having an effect, have you considered capitalizing on the fact you do offer a download? For example create a downloads page, adding appropriate keywords, call to action content (ie buy pro version ), ad-blocks (if appropriate), download review section (to garner trust), and notable mirrors with same download content if applicable.
This would do 2 things, first add value to your site, and completely remove the fear of the download having any negative impact on the page in question.
